Air leak between brake booster and master cylinder
91 civic stock bb and mc, when the car is idling i can hear a pretty big air leak coming from the bottom of the mc and bb. If i poke my finger around I can hear the sound change. What exactly do I need to replace to fix the leak? I'd prefer not to have to replace everything if I don't have to but I also cant seem to find any sort of gasket that's mean to go there either. Also I don't have any problems braking or anything like that.
There is only a single vacuum hose that runs to the booster. Check it to see if it has split or cracked.
If it is in good condition, the your booster is leaking. The only way to fix that is to replace it.
You might be able to unbolt the MC and remove the booster without having to open the hydraulic lines, but I'm doubtful that is actually possible.... Just wishful thinking probably.
The booster clips to the brake pedal with just one pin. It is then held to the firewall with 4 nuts under the dash. They are accessed from under the dash - 2 are really easy to get at and the other two will likely have you wishing you never owned a car.
